Hands down for me, the Yamaha A R.T. transducer pickup found in both my FGX730SCA, and LLX6A. They still use this pickup in a couple steel string guitars -- a really small bodied one, the CPX700, and a few nylon string models. I have no idea why they don't use it with the SRT modeling systems. Very natural sounding pickups with absolutely no piezo quack. Works well for percussive looping too.
